The Ariel Glaser Pediatric AIDS Healthcare initiative (AGPAHI), an affiliate of Elizabeth Glaser Pediatric AIDS Organization (EGPAF) is Tanzanian led and managed national organization focusing largely on HIV and AIDS and other related health programs. AGPAHI implements all its programs in collaboration with Tanzania Government Entities through the Ministry of Health, Community Development, Gender, Elderly and Children (MoHCDGEC) and presidential Office
- Regional Administration and Local Government (PO RALG) and other stakeholders. AGPAHI supports the provision of high-quality HIV and other health services and ensures that efforts are well integrated into existing regional and district health systems.

Position Overview:
The Senior Program Officer Strategic information (SPO-SI) will work as a key member of AGPAHI Technical team and is responsible for overall regional coordination of quality improvement; monitoring and evaluation activities at AGPAHI supported regions. SPO SI will work in close collaboration with other technical team members to ensure that the data management system captures all regional data relevant for the monitoring and reporting of AGPAH! programs and to monitor regional QI initiatives for program improvement. The SPO SI will supervise regional Program Officers M&E, Data Management Officers and Program Officers Quality improvement.
